Is this PSU good enough to power two GTX 970s?

I had the same question a few days ago (aout a NZXT hale 82 650w in my case), and the answer I received was:

Yes, it is enough, but it's barely enough. Not recommended, and you might have issues taking into account that the cards sometimes draw far more power than their TDP.
Still, it will probably work OK, but 650W is the minimum possible.

(TDP is their Thermal Design Power, not electric power. The difference here would be that the thermal power is more like an average, whereas the electrical power could change up and down rapidly, as long as the average is still within the TDP)
